Introduction: Dremel - All Purpose Penny Cutting Blade
This instructable shows the process of making your own all purpose cutting blade for a Dremel made from a penny.

Step 1: Materials and Tools
Tools
Metal Bandsaw or Hacksaw - to see my homemade table bandsaw instrucable click HERE
Pencil
Drill press and bit
File
Grinder
Center finder
Center Punch
Materials
coin or round steel
Dremel cutting wheel bit
Step 2: Preparation for Drilling
- Grind or Sand he penny/coin flat
- Find the center using a jig
- Mark the center using a center punch
Step 3: Drilling and Designing
- Drill the hole in the center
- Draw a saw blade like pattern using your pencil
Step 4: Cutting and Shaping
- Cut the shape out using a metal Bandsaw, hacksaw or file.
